For moms preparing for a maternity session, my biggest tip is to wear something you can move in. Flowing dresses or layers make hiking or exploring easy and comfortable. Bring a small personal item like baby shoes, a blanket, or a scarf to add a little personality.
Most importantly, don’t stress. The more relaxed you are, the better your photos will turn out.
